大家好!我现在需要解决的问题是: kk6Af\NZ
假设有一个很小的空间,里面悬浮着很多与波长尺寸相当的微粒,小空间外面是远大于波长的物质结构。要求观察入射光在这个小空间被微粒多重散射后,再被物质结构反射/透射产生的远场分布情况。 !g=2U`j^
k/MrNiC
就我的理解,Zemax因为使用了光线的近似,是无法处理尺寸与波长相当的物体产生的衍射/散射问题的。但是,它可以较好地处理大结构物质的反射、透射问题。而FDTD在小范围内求解得到的光场是很准确的,但它的致命缺点是对cpu和内存要求极高,只能在很有限的三维空间(一般几个波长)内进行计算,无法处理大结构物质的反射、透射问题。 Fk01j;k.H
L1'R6W~%dN
所以我感觉上面陈述的这个问题,单独使用Zemax或者是FDTD其中一个是无法解决的。有没有可能把两个方法结合起来呢?比如说,我用FDTD得到了近场的三维分布,然后把它近似转化为Zemax里面的光线,再用ray-tracing的方法得到远场分布?但是,这个转化应该怎么进行呢?不知道Zemax有没有这个功能?我现在觉得有可能的是通过空间傅里叶变换(但那也是建立在近轴的基础上的),但具体怎么做还没想通。 neN #Mo'A
G.CkceWRn
不知道把问题说清楚没有。我是新人,对Zemax不甚了解,希望大家不吝赐教。 d\% |!ix
X?PcEAi;w
|Tn+Aq7